## Deploying the Gatewick Proctor Queue

Deploys are pretty painless: push to main, wait for the pipeline, then watch the queue drain dashboard for five minutes. If candidates pile up mid-exam, roll back first and ask questions later — the queue replays safely. Everything the workers care about lives in one config block, shown here for reference.

settings of bafof-yagef:
JOROX_PIN=8740
JOROX_TENANT=pelox
JOROX_METRICS_HOST=metrics.jorox.qorvelworks.internal
JOROX_SEAL=seal_c78f63c1
JOROX_STANDBY_TEAM=norax

Hey — quick handover before the cutover. We're finally killing the old Crankshaft job queue and moving everything to Relaydo. Workers are drained, DLQ is empty, and the migration script is staged on the Pellworth box. Last step before you flip the release flag: unlock the migration vault, which will ask for the passphrase below.

unlock words, tawif-tahop: oliys-ulawyn-tamdor-lamys-casox-jormir-fraius-kasath-ulador-ulamir-holir-sorys-holeth

## Changelog — Ticktrace 1.9

### Renamed: DRIFT_API_TOKEN
During the cron drift investigation we found plugins confusing this variable with the metrics token, so it has been renamed to indicate it authorizes drift-report uploads specifically. Plugin authors must read the new name from 1.9 onward; the old name is ignored without warning. Sample env files in the SDK are updated. In your deployment env file, the drift-report upload secret is set on the next line.

env line for fawef-taguf: VAULT_KEY13=a9695905a9a90

The host
# and port vars below are boring and rarely change. What DOES change
# is the feed credential, rotated every release by whoever cuts the
# tag. If the dashboard shows the garage stuck at 0% full, it's
# almost always a stale credential, not the sensors. Rotate it,
# redeploy, done. The current credential sits on the next line.

env line for fafof-fahag: LEDGER_TOKEN5=f8790